Manchester United supporters were livid after Daniel James was allowed to continue playing during Wales’ match against Croatia on Sunday evening despite appearing to be knocked out after a nasty collision.

James was out cold when Domagoj Vida attacked a high ball with him and struck James in the head, leaving him sprawled out on the floor.

Two members of the medical staff quickly ran onto the pitch to attend to the former Swansea man, but thankfully he got to his feet and was able to make his way off the field.

Much to the chagrin of United supporters, however, he then played on, despite worries that doing so could cause further damage.

With United facing a huge match against bitter rivalsLiverpoolafter the international break on October 20, the last thing they need is another injury, especially to arguably one of their best players so far this season.

James has scored three times in ten games for Ole Gunnar Solskjaer’s side since his move from the Swans in the summer, and has been one of the most threatening-looking players in a United team which has often struggled for goals.

Football has seen a number of worrying collision incidents recently, and one of the most high-profile was that of Tottenham’s Jan Vertonghen.

The Belgian defender was left with blood pouring from his face after a clash of heads in a game against Ajax. After leaving the pitch he returned to the field soon after, but it soon became apparent that he was in no fit state to continue, and he was eventually substituted.

Former Spurs player Ryan Mason was critical of the James situation.

Mason was forced to retire in 2017 when he fractured his skull againstChelsea, and posted on (Twitter) saying: “Daniel James was just knocked unconscious! Yet 3 minutes later he has been allowed back onto the pitch.”
